Wait a while for them to settle.

Cutting the bump stops won't do anything for the static height. It gets you a little more suspension travel at full compression (ie: you're less likely to bottom the suspension on big dips on the road.)

I would cut the bump stops if you have a bottoming issue, otherwise leave it so you don't have to disassemble the suspension.

I should have cut my bump stops on my Civic when I lowered it, but I followed the Eibach instructions NOT to cut them (they were Prokit springs), and ended up bottoming on large dips. Rather than disassembling everything, I just cranked up my Illuminas a notch. Wife hates it now, because then ride is so damn stiff.
